Across TCGA patient cohorts, CRTC2 RNA expression is significantly associated with the protein abundance of many other proteins, with 10,495 significant associations in total. LSCC shows the largest number of these associations.

The most reproducible CRTC2-associated proteins across cancer lineages are DHX9, GATAD2B, and WDR5. Each is linked with CRTC2 in more than 7 cancer types. Because this analysis shows association rather than direction, both CRTC2-to-partner and partner-to-CRTC2 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, CRTC2 versus DHX9 in LSCC, with a Pearson correlation of 0.42.
